UPDATE 1-Greece's StealthGas Q1 profit beats Street
* Q1 adj EPS $0.14 vs est $0.10
* Q1 revenue falls 1 pct, but beats estimates
May 12 (Reuters) - StealthGas Inc (GASS.O), which operates ships that transport liquefied petroleum gas, reported first-quarter profit above market estimates, helped by increased spot market activity.
For the quarter, the Greek company posted a net income of $1.6 million, or 7 cents a share, compared with $200,000, or 1 cent a share, a year ago.
Excluding items, the company earned 14 cents a share.
Revenue fell 1 percent to $28.8 million.
Analysts on average expected StealthGas to post a profit of 10 cents per share, on revenue of $27.2 million, according to Thomson Reuters I/B/E/S.
Spot market activity during the quarter increased to 851 spot voyage days, compared with 501 spot voyage days last year.
Shares of the company were up 4 cents at $5.21 Wednesday morning on Nasdaq. (Reporting by Vinay Sarawagi in Bangalore; Editing by Maju Samuel)
